Output 6871ba765dce61f2a695e0f134ebc440fe095022b5898a58dba9a9be932523f8:1

value
594878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 abfde4a824b04837f67e08f7c0a790571b1e0e6e OP_EQUALVERIFY OP_CHECKSIG
address
1GgQhcSvKdiLumLu3CX3SCZ5Bgboq3hU5u
transaction
6871ba765dce61f2a695e0f134ebc440fe095022b5898a58dba9a9be932523f8
spent
true